Sie sind auf Seite 1von 27

Ampliacin de Redes de Computadores (4 II)

REDES ATM
Modo de Transferencia Asncrono

Luis Orozco

Tema 5: Redes ATM

3-1

Ampliacin de Redes de Computadores (4 II)

Plan de la Unidad
Revisin de Conceptos de Base Introduccin a Redes ATM Modelo B-ISDN Arquitectura de Protocolos ATM Aplicaciones

Luis Orozco

Tema 5: Redes ATM

3-2

Page 1

Ampliacin de Redes de Computadores (4 II)

Conmutacin
Definicin: La red debe ser capaz de interconectar a sus abonados a fin de permitirles de intercambiar informacin de manera rpida y eficiente. La propiedad de establecer la interconexin de los usuarios de manera dinmica se denomina conmutacin.

Luis Orozco

Tema 5: Redes ATM

3-3

Ampliacin de Redes de Computadores (4 II)

Conmutacin de Circuitos y de Paquetes


conmutacin de circuitos : una conexin fsica es establecida al inicio de la comunicacin y dedicada a la conexin entre los usuarios durante toda la comunicacin conmutacin de paquetes: no requiere una conexin fsica entre los abonados. La informacin es transmitida en paquetes a travs la red de comunicacin.
Luis Orozco

Tema 5: Redes ATM

3-4

Page 2

Ampliacin de Redes de Computadores (4 II)

Datagrama vs. Circuito Virtual


Datagrama - cada paquete es marcado con la direccin de la destinacin. Los paquetes son enviados y enrutados de manera independiente (el uno del otro) Circuito Virtual -los paquetes son enviados a travs la misma ruta, llamada circuito virtual

Luis Orozco

Tema 5: Redes ATM

3-5

Ampliacin de Redes de Computadores (4 II)

Datagrama vs. Circuito Virtual


Conmutacin de Circuitos - esta tcnica es usada para las comunicaciones sncronas Conmutacin de Paquetes - mejor opcin para el trfico bursty
Circuito Virtual - eficiente en el caso de la transmisin de grandes cantidades de informacin Datagramas - tiles en el caso de transmisin de mensajes cortos

Luis Orozco

Tema 5: Redes ATM

3-6

Page 3

Ampliacin de Redes de Computadores (4 II)

Multiplexacin (1)
Definicin
consiste a transmitir varios flujos de informacin sobre la misma lnea fsica. Donde un flujo de informacin representa la secuencia de paquetes enviada de un usuario a un otro.
1 2 MUX N MUX N
Luis Orozco

1 2

Tema 5: Redes ATM

3-7

Ampliacin de Redes de Computadores (4 II)

Multiplexacin (2)
Dos tcnicas de base multiplexacin en frecuencia (FDM) multiplexacin en tiempo (TDM)

Luis Orozco

Tema 5: Redes ATM

3-8

Page 4

Ampliacin de Redes de Computadores (4 II)

Multiplexacin en Frecuencia
Los usuarios utilizan el mismo canal fsico. Sin embargo cada usuario usa una frecuencia diferente.
1 2 3 1

canal 1
M UX

canal 2

M DE

UX

canal N
N
Tema 5: Redes ATM
3-9

N
Luis Orozco

Ampliacin de Redes de Computadores (4 II)

Multiplexacin en Tiempo
Multiplexacin sncrona (STDM) STDM - el sistema asigna de manera secuencial una ranura(temporal) a cada uno de los usuarios.Las ranuras son organizadas en marcos Multiplexacin asncrona (ATDM) ATDM es una tcnica en la cual las ranuras son asignadas de manera dinmica, en funcin de la actividad del usuario. ATDM es una tcnica particularmente til en el caso que los usuarios no siempre tengan datos que enviar. La ventaja principal de esta tcnica es el de incrementar la tasa de utilizacin del canal de comunicacin. Luis Orozco
Tema 5: Redes ATM
3 - 10

Page 5

Ampliacin de Redes de Computadores (4 II)

Multiplexacin Sncrona vs. Asncrona


buffer m1(t) marco m2(t)
12 N 12 N

buffer m1(t) marco m2(t)

mn(t)

mn(t)

operacin de seleccin
Luis Orozco

Tema 5: Redes ATM

3 - 11

Ampliacin de Redes de Computadores (4 II)

Introduccin a ATM
RAZON DE SER DE B-ISDN

crear una red de comunicacin capaz de poder dar servicio a una gran variedad de servicios con diferentes caractersticas (tasas de transmisin y requerimientos en calidad de servicios) ejemplos: voz digital : tiempo de respuesta limitado, tazas de prdidas limitadas datos : deben transmitirse sin error ni prdidas la red debe ser diseada de tal forma que pueda dar servicio a las diferentes aplicaciones
Luis Orozco

Tema 5: Redes ATM

3 - 12

Page 6

Ampliacin de Redes de Computadores (4 II)

ATM
Qu es ATM?
el mecanismo de transporte de la red B-ISDN una tcnica de conmutacin y de multiplexacin para las redes de computadoras de banda ancha Ventajas ATM debe ofrecer una gran flexibilidad en tasas de transmisin y de integracin de servicios ATM es particularmente til para el trafico de tipo bursty
Luis Orozco

Tema 5: Redes ATM

3 - 13

Ampliacin de Redes de Computadores (4 II)

Tcnica ATM
Conmutacin y Multiplexacin en paquetes basadas en celdas Una celda es un paquete de tamao fijo (constante)

Header

Information Field

5 octets 53

48

octets

octets
Luis Orozco

Tema 5: Redes ATM

3 - 14

Page 7

Ampliacin de Redes de Computadores (4 II)

Caractersticas de ATM
ATM es asncrono en el sentido de que las celdas asociadas a una comunicacin aparecen a intervalos irregulares. ATM utiliza el principio de conexin (circuito virtual). las celdas son conmutadas utilizando los identificadores de camino y circuito virtual (VPI/VCI : virtual path/virtual circuit identifier).
Luis Orozco

Tema 5: Redes ATM

3 - 15

Ampliacin de Redes de Computadores (4 II)

Modelo de Red
UNI NNI

TE

NT2

NT1

ATM mux

ATM switch

Equipo del Usuario

Acceso a la Red

Red

TE : Terminal Equipment NT-1 : Network Termination 1 NT-2 : Network Termination 2


Tema 5: Redes ATM
3 - 16

UNI : User - Network Interface NNI - Network Node Termination


Luis Orozco

Page 8

Ampliacin de Redes de Computadores (4 II)

Redes ATM
Las funciones y los mecanismos de control para el transporte de la informacin son organizadas de manera jerrquica. La capacidad de las lneas es subdividida en VP (rutas virtuales) y estos a su vez en VC (circuitos virtuales).

Luis Orozco

Tema 5: Redes ATM

3 - 17

Ampliacin de Redes de Computadores (4 II)

Relacin Jerrquica

Canales Virtuales

Camino Virtual

Canal de Transmisin

Luis Orozco

Tema 5: Redes ATM

3 - 18

Page 9

Ampliacin de Redes de Computadores (4 II)

Conmutacin ATM (1)

Luis Orozco

Tema 5: Redes ATM

3 - 19

Ampliacin de Redes de Computadores (4 II)

Conmutacin ATM (2)

Luis Orozco

Tema 5: Redes ATM

3 - 20

Page 10

Ampliacin de Redes de Computadores (4 II)

Canal Virtual
Canal Virtual denota una comunicacin unidireccional utilizada para transportar celdas ATM. Un numero diferente de identificador de VC (VCI) es utilizado en cada conmutador VC.

Luis Orozco

Tema 5: Redes ATM

3 - 21

Ampliacin de Redes de Computadores (4 II)

Camino Virtual (1)


Un Camino Virtual denota un grupo de canales virtuales que tienen los mismos puntos de accesos a ambos extremidades de la conexin. Un identificador de caminos virtual (VPI) es asignado cada vez que un VP es conmutado dentro de la red.

Luis Orozco

Tema 5: Redes ATM

3 - 22

Page 11

Ampliacin de Redes de Computadores (4 II)

Camino Virtual (2)


Para que puede servir un Camino Virtual? ATM puede ofrecer la posibilidad de definir redes virtuales (virtual private data networks, VPDN). Ejemplo: Una organizacin puede servirse de este principio para definir una red virtual dentro de una red fsica.
Luis Orozco

Tema 5: Redes ATM

3 - 23

Ampliacin de Redes de Computadores (4 II)

Modelo B-ISDN
Plano Administracin
Administracin de Capas Plano Administracin

Plano Control

Plano Usuario

Capas Altas Capa Adaptacin ATM (AAL) Capa ATM Capa Fsica

Luis Orozco

Tema 5: Redes ATM

3 - 24

Page 12

Ampliacin de Redes de Computadores (4 II)

Capas de la Arquitectura de Protocolos


Capa Fsica Capa ATM Capa Adaptacin ATM Capa Aplicacin

Luis Orozco

Tema 5: Redes ATM

3 - 25

Ampliacin de Redes de Computadores (4 II)

Capa Fsica
Dos mtodos diferentes mtodo ATM puro - a nivel fsico se transmite una secuencia constante de celdas ATM. La sincronizacin se obtiene a partir de esta secuencia. la sincronizacin es llevada a cabo utilizando el campo HEC (header error control). ventaja: simplicidad de la interfaz
Luis Orozco

Tema 5: Redes ATM

3 - 26

Page 13

Ampliacin de Redes de Computadores (4 II)

Mtodo por celdas ATM


Sincronizacin se lleva a cabo usando el campo de control de error del encabezado (HEC):
Procedimiento: Estado HUNT : se va detectando bit a bit la llegada de una celda para ello se verifica el campo HEC Estado PRESYNCH, una vez detectado el campo HEC se continua verificando este. La sincronizacin se logra cuando se detectan celdas de manera consecutiva. Estado SYNCH, el campo HEC es usado para detectar errores o la perdida de sincronizacin. La perdida de sincronizacin es detectada si no se logra detectar el HEC veces de manera consecutiva.
Luis Orozco

Tema 5: Redes ATM

3 - 27

Ampliacin de Redes de Computadores (4 II)

Sincronizacin por celdas ATM


Bit por bit HEC correcto?

HUNT
Celda por celda HEC Incorrecto? HEC incorrecto veces consecutivas? HEC correcto veces consecutivas?

PRESYNC

SYNCH

Luis Orozco

Tema 5: Redes ATM

3 - 28

Page 14

Ampliacin de Redes de Computadores (4 II)

Capa Fsica
Mtodo SDH la sincronizacin es llevada a cabo usando la jerarqua STM-1 (STS3). Es decir, la capa fsica ofrece la estructura bsica de sincronizacin. Ventaja: la jerarqua SDH ya es utilizada en la comunicacin digital de voz.
Luis Orozco

Tema 5: Redes ATM

3 - 29

Ampliacin de Redes de Computadores (4 II)

Transmisin ATM usando SDH


Encabezado
260 columnas

53 bytes

9 renglones

Luis Orozco

Tema 5: Redes ATM

3 - 30

Page 15

Ampliacin de Redes de Computadores (4 II)

Capa ATM
Funciones
dos subcapas : ATM VP y ATM VC. funciones de multiplexacin a nivel de VC y de VP enrutado de celdas de acuerdo a los valores del VPI y del VCI. supervisin del flujo de celdas a fin de poder verificar que el flujo no exceda los limites acordados entre el usuario y la red.
Luis Orozco

Tema 5: Redes ATM

3 - 31

Ampliacin de Redes de Computadores (4 II)

Encabezado de la Celda
First bit transmitted 1 (MSB) 2 3 4 5 6 7 8 (LSB)

1 2 Octet 3 4 5

GFC / VPI VPI VCI VCI HEC

VPI VCI

PTI

CLP

Luis Orozco

Tema 5: Redes ATM

3 - 32

Page 16

Ampliacin de Redes de Computadores (4 II)

Campos del Encabezado de la Celda (1)


Generic Flow Control (GFC) -usado para controlar el flujo de trafico en proveniencia del usuario. Este control solo se aplica a nivel de la interfaz usuario-red (UNI) Virtual Path Identifier/Virtual Channel Identifier (VPI/VCI) - informacin utilizada por la funcin de enrutamiento Payload Type (PT) - usado para identificar el tipo de celda: celda de informacin o de control. Las funciones de control de congestin puede usar este campo.

Luis Orozco

Tema 5: Redes ATM

3 - 33

Ampliacin de Redes de Computadores (4 II)

Campos del Encabezado de la Celda (2)


Explicit Forward Congestion Indication Este campo puede ser usado para permitir a los conmutadores el indicar un estado de congestin.

Campo de Prioridad (CLP)


Si CLP = 1, la celda es de baja prioridad y puede ser descartada si la red esta congestionada. Si CLP = 0, la celda es de alta prioridad.

Luis Orozco

Tema 5: Redes ATM

3 - 34

Page 17

Ampliacin de Redes de Computadores (4 II)

Campos del Encabezados de la Celda (3)


Header Error Control (HEC) utilizado por la capa fsica a fin de corregir errores en el encabezado. El polinomio generador adoptado por la organizacin ATM forum es:

x8 + x2 + x + 1

Luis Orozco

Tema 5: Redes ATM

3 - 35

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(1)


Class A Class B Class C Class D

Timing relation between source and destination Bit rate Connection mode AAL Protocol Type 1

Required

Not required

Constant Connection-oriented Type 2

Variable Connectionless Type 3/4

Type 3/4, Type 5

Luis Orozco

Tema 5: Redes ATM

3 - 36

Page 18

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(2)


dos subcapas lgicas: la subcapa convergencia (CS) - integra las funciones necesarias para dar servicio de acuerdo a los requisitos de cada aplicacin. la subcapa de segmentacin y rensamblado (SAR) - responsable de formar las celdas utilizando la informacin en proveniencia de la capa CS y de recuperar la informacin a partir de las celdas que recibe de la capa ATM.
Luis Orozco

Tema 5: Redes ATM

3 - 37

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(3)


Clases cuatro clases de servicios : clases A, B, C y D. las clases han sido definidas de acuerdo a los requisitos de las diferentes aplicaciones en trminos de:
sincronizacin, tasas de transmisin y tipo de servicio : con o sin conexin.

Luis Orozco

Tema 5: Redes ATM

3 - 38

Page 19

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(4)


Clase A - emulacin de circuitos y servicios de voz y de video a tasa de transmisin constante. Clase B - video y voz a tasa de transmisin variable. Clase C - transmisin de datos en modo conectado (CO) Clase D - transmisin de datos en modo sin conexin (CL)
Luis Orozco

Tema 5: Redes ATM

3 - 39

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(5)


Protocolos un tipo protocolo para cada clase de servicio cuatro tipos han sido definidos Tipos 1, 2, 3/4 y 5 cada tipo de protocolo consiste de dos subcapas: CS y SAR. los protocolos de tipos 3 y 4 corresponden a un solo tipo llamado Tipo 3/4
Luis Orozco

Tema 5: Redes ATM

3 - 40

Page 20

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(6)


AAL Tipo 1 Sub-capa SAR - antes de transmitir organiza los bits en celdas; en recepcin recupera los bits de las celdas. Cada celda consiste de: un numero de secuencia (SN) a fin de poder detectar perdidas de informacin un campo de proteccin del numero de secuencia (SNP) para poder detectar errores y corregirlos. Sub-capa CS - temporizacin y sincronizacin.
Luis Orozco

Tema 5: Redes ATM

3 - 41

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(7)


AAL Tipo 2 transferencia de unidades de datos de servicio (SDUs) a tasa de transmisin variable (VBR) transferencia de informacin de temporizacin entre el transmisor y el receptor. no ofrece la posibilidad de detectar errores o perdidas de informacin las funciones de las subcapas SAR y CS no han sido aun definidas.

Luis Orozco

Tema 5: Redes ATM

3 - 42

Page 21

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(8)


AAL Tipos 3/4 el servicio puede ser con o sin conexin el servicio puede ser proporcionado en modo mensaje o en modo stream (secuencia continua) modo mensaje : un protocolo de lnea puede ser usado modo stream : transferencia de informacin a baja velocidad de manera continua pero con un tiempo corto de respuesta.

Luis Orozco

Tema 5: Redes ATM

3 - 43

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(9)


AAL Tipos 1 y 3/4 Ejemplo:

Luis Orozco

Tema 5: Redes ATM

3 - 44

Page 22

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(10)


AAL Tipo 5 mnimo overhead en procesamiento. mnimo overhead durante la transmisin. promete le interconexin con protocolo de transporte ya existentes.

Luis Orozco

Tema 5: Redes ATM

3 - 45

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(11)


AAL Tipo 5 - CPCS PDU CPCS-UU - utilizado para transmitir informacin de manera transparente de usuario a usuario Common Part Indicator - en estudio Cyclic redundancy check (CRC) - usado para detectar errores en la transmisin Length -nmero de bytes de informacin contenida en el CPCS PDU

Luis Orozco

Tema 5: Redes ATM

3 - 46

Page 23

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(12)


AAL CPCS PDU Tipo 5 Ejemplo:

Luis Orozco

Tema 5: Redes ATM

3 - 47

Ampliacin de Redes de Computadores (4 II)

Capa Adaptacin ATM (13)


Transmisin AAL5 Ejemplo:

Luis Orozco

Tema 5: Redes ATM

3 - 48

Page 24

Ampliacin de Redes de Computadores (4 II)

Interconexin (1)

Luis Orozco

Tema 5: Redes ATM

3 - 49

Ampliacin de Redes de Computadores (4 II)

Interconexin (2)

Luis Orozco

Tema 5: Redes ATM

3 - 50

Page 25

Ampliacin de Redes de Computadores (4 II)

Servicios B-ISDN
Dos tipos de servicios interactivos - la informacin fluye en ambas
direcciones (usuario <--> red).

distribucin - el usuario recibe la informacin y


puede o no controlar la manera en que la presentacin de la informacin.

Luis Orozco

Tema 5: Redes ATM

3 - 51

Ampliacin de Redes de Computadores (4 II)

Servicios Interactivos (1)


Servicios de mensajera
correo electrnico textual correo electrnico con video ...

Servicios de acceso a bases de datos


datos documentos videotex video imgenes de alta resolucin ...
Luis Orozco

Tema 5: Redes ATM

3 - 52

Page 26

Ampliacin de Redes de Computadores (4 II)

Servicios Interactivos (2)


Servicios Conversacionales
videotelefona videoconferencia ...

Luis Orozco

Tema 5: Redes ATM

3 - 53

Ampliacin de Redes de Computadores (4 II)

Servicios de Distribucin
televisin televisin - pay per view videografa (voz, datos e imgenes) distribucin de video televisin en alta resolucin (HDTV) ...

Luis Orozco

Tema 5: Redes ATM

3 - 54

Page 27

Das könnte Ihnen auch gefallen